I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

C++/CLI Discussion :

[C++]sizeof d'un objet manag�e


Sujet :

C++/CLI

Vue hybride

Message pr�c�dent Message pr�c�dent   Message suivant Message suivant
  1. #1
    Membre confirm�
    Inscrit en
    Mars 2003
    Messages
    103
    D�tails du profil
    Informations forums :
    Inscription : Mars 2003
    Messages : 103
    Par d�faut [C++]sizeof d'un objet manag�e
    La question est dans l'intitul�.

    Je recherche a connetre la taille de mes objets manag�es.

    La fonction sizeof ne passe pas a la compilation.


    Quelle methode doit-on utilis�?



    Je n'ai pas trouv� de reponse dans les anciens messages du forum.
    Ou suis-je bete?

    Merci

  2. #2
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414

  3. #3
    Membre confirm�
    Inscrit en
    Mars 2003
    Messages
    103
    D�tails du profil
    Informations forums :
    Inscription : Mars 2003
    Messages : 103
    Par d�faut
    Merci pour cette reponse,

    cela ma permis d'aller un peu plus loin.

    en ajoutant:
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    [StructLayout(LayoutKind::Sequential)]
    avant la definition des class dont on souhaite connaitre leur taille

    Par contre je tombe sur une classe qui possede en donn�es membres une ArrayList. Je n'arrive pas a trouver les parametres necessaires pour bien marshalis� cette ArrayList. quel unmanagedtype dois-je utiliser?

    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    [MarshalAs(UnmanagedType:: ??? , ??? )]

    Meme probleme avec une donn�e membre qui est un pointeur vers un objet manag�.

  4. #4
    R�dacteur
    Avatar de nico-pyright(c)
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    6 414
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 6 414
    Par d�faut
    tu veux faire quoi ? y a quoi dans cette arraylist ?

  5. #5
    Membre confirm�
    Inscrit en
    Mars 2003
    Messages
    103
    D�tails du profil
    Informations forums :
    Inscription : Mars 2003
    Messages : 103
    Par d�faut
    Je voulais connaitre la taille memoire que prenait cette ArrayList.

    Ensuite si cette ArrayList aggr�geait des objects,
    j'aurai boucl� sur les �l�ment de l'ArrayList pour connaitre la taille de chaque �l�ment.


    Dans mes ArrayList j'ai des objets manag� (mes objets)

Discussions similaires

  1. Objets manag�s via un s�quenceur C++
    Par Troopers dans le forum C#
    R�ponses: 1
    Dernier message: 31/03/2010, 12h40
  2. Handle d'objet manag� c# 1.1
    Par chental dans le forum C#
    R�ponses: 7
    Dernier message: 16/04/2009, 22h34
  3. R�ponses: 1
    Dernier message: 26/02/2008, 12h54
  4. Tableau d'objet manag�
    Par alexadvance dans le forum Visual C++
    R�ponses: 8
    Dernier message: 23/03/2007, 09h20
  5. Probleme utilisation d'Objets manag� grace a gcroot
    Par pepefourras dans le forum MFC
    R�ponses: 4
    Dernier message: 16/05/2006, 00h26

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o